Trip information

Departure: Rochester, NY
Arrival: Charlotte, NC
Fastest route: 20h 35min
Distance: 1063km
Cheapest route: $107
Transfers: Between 0 and 2
Bus companies: Greyhound, New York Trailways

Cheap bus schedules leaving on Friday

One Passenger / One Trip

7:50am

Rochester, NY

Rochester NY Trailways Bus Station

4:25am

Charlotte, NC

Charlotte Greyhound Bus Station

20h 35min

Greyhound

$107

10:55am

Rochester, NY

Rochester NY Trailways Bus Station

9:55am

Charlotte, NC

Charlotte Greyhound Bus Station

23h 0min

Greyhound

$180.5

2:00pm

Rochester, NY

Rochester Institute of Technology Bus Stop (Grace Watson Hall)

2:45pm

Charlotte, NC

Charlotte Greyhound Bus Station

24h 45min

++ 2 layovers

$119

Multiple companies

2:00pm

Rochester, NY

Rochester Institute of Technology Bus Stop (Grace Watson Hall)

10:15pm

New York, NY

Port Authority Bus Terminal

8h 15min

New York Trailways

$48.5

0h 15min layover

10:30pm

New York, NY

Port Authority Bus Terminal

5:20am

Richmond, VA

Richmond Greyhound Bus Station

6h 50min

Greyhound

$48.5

1h 20min layover

6:40am

Richmond, VA

Richmond Greyhound Bus Station

2:45pm

Charlotte, NC

Charlotte Greyhound Bus Station

8h 5min

Greyhound

$22

2:20pm

Rochester, NY

University of Rochester Bus Stop (Rush Rhees Library)

2:45pm

Charlotte, NC

Charlotte Greyhound Bus Station

24h 25min

++ 2 layovers

$119

Multiple companies

2:20pm

Rochester, NY

University of Rochester Bus Stop (Rush Rhees Library)

10:15pm

New York, NY

Port Authority Bus Terminal

7h 55min

New York Trailways

$48.5

0h 15min layover

10:30pm

New York, NY

Port Authority Bus Terminal

5:20am

Richmond, VA

Richmond Greyhound Bus Station

6h 50min

Greyhound

$48.5

1h 20min layover

6:40am

Richmond, VA

Richmond Greyhound Bus Station

2:45pm

Charlotte, NC

Charlotte Greyhound Bus Station

8h 5min

Greyhound

$22

2:25pm

Rochester, NY

Rochester NY Trailways Bus Station

2:45pm

Charlotte, NC

Charlotte Greyhound Bus Station

24h 20min

Greyhound

$107

4:55pm

Rochester, NY

Rochester NY Trailways Bus Station

3:20pm

Charlotte, NC

Charlotte Greyhound Bus Station

22h 25min

Greyhound

$107

Overview

Traveling from Rochester to Charlotte by bus

First departure
7:50am
Avg price
$123.25
Carriers
2
Last arrival
3:20pm

Bus information Rochester - Charlotte

The Rochester - Charlotte route has approximately 6 frequencies and its minimum duration is around 20h 35min. It is important you book your ticket in advance to avoid running out, since $107 tickets tend to run out quickly.
The distance between Rochester and Charlotte is around 1063 kilometers and the bus companies that can help you in your journey are: Greyhound, New York Trailways.

  • Trips per day 6
  • Direct trips 4

How long does it take to get from Rochester to Charlotte by bus?

Bus journey may vary depending on the state of the roads. The minimum duration is usually around 20h 35min to cover 1063 kilometers.

I'm looking for cheap tickets for this route ...

According to our data, the cheapest ticket costs $107 and leaves Rochester NY Trailways Bus Station. You will not have to do any transfers, the trip will go directly to Charlotte Greyhound Bus Station.

  • Avg duration 23h 15min
  • Cheapest price $107

What time does the last bus leave?

Last bus leaves at 4:55pm from Rochester NY Trailways Bus Station and arrives at 3:20pm at Charlotte Greyhound Bus Station. It will take 22h 25min, its price is $107 and the number of changes will be 0.

Are there any direct routes between Rochester and Charlotte?

Yes, there are direct bus routes, their duration is usually around 20h 35min and the price is $107.

  • Last bus 4:55pm
  • Transfers 0

What are the bus stations in Rochester?

  • Rochester Institute of Technology Bus Stop (Grace Watson Hall)
    61 Lomb Memorial Dr
    Rochester, NY 14623
  • University of Rochester Bus Stop (Rush Rhees Library)
    755 Library Road
    Rochester, NY 14627
  • Rochester NY Trailways Bus Station
    186 Cumberland St (Across from the Amtrak Terminal)
    Rochester, NY 14605

What are the bus stations in Charlotte?

  • Charlotte Greyhound Bus Station
    601 W Trade St
    Charlotte, NC 28202
We use cookies to enhance your browsing experience. By using this site, you agree to our use of cookies. More information: Cookies Policy